The Automotive Virtualization Hypervisor market is a segment of the automotive technology landscape focused on virtualization solutions for in-vehicle electronic control units (ECUs) and systems. A Virtualization Hypervisor allows multiple operating systems (OS) and software applications to run on a single hardware platform simultaneously, isolating them from one another. In the automotive context, this technology is applied to enhance the efficiency, flexibility, and safety of various vehicle functions.In-Vehicle Electronic Control Units (ECUs):Automotive Virtualization Hypervisors are utilized to consolidate and manage multiple functions performed by in-vehicle ECUs, reducing hardware complexity and enhancing resource utilization.Enhanced Functional Safety:The use of virtualization technology contributes to enhanced functional safety by providing isolation between critical and non-critical functions, preventing interference in the event of a failure.Flexibility and Scalability:Virtualization allows for greater flexibility and scalability in the development and deployment of software applications, enabling easier updates and integration of new functionalities.

The global Automotive Virtualization Hypervisor market size was estimated at USD 434.0 million in 2025 and is projected to grow at a compound annual growth rate (CAGR) of 34.80% during the forecast period.
